I. General Description

[0037] As indicated above, the present invention provides an autonomic sensor network in a multi-network environment. Specifically, the present invention provides a method, system and program product for deploying, allocating and providing backup for an autonomic sensor network ecosystem. Under the present invention, the autonomic sensor network ecosystem includes: (1) a set (e.g., one or more) of sensor / peer networks for storing data components; (2) a set of sensor collector information gateways in communication with the sensor networks; and (3) a set of enterprise gateways and storage hubs (hereinafter referred to as enterprise gateways) in communication with the sensor collector information gateways. Abstract

The present invention provides a method, system and program product for deploying, allocating and providing backup for an autonomic sensor network ecosystem. Under the present invention, the autonomic sensor network ecosystem includes: (1) a set (e.g., one or more) of sensor networks for storing data components; (2) a set of sensor collector information gateways in communication with the sensor networks; and (3) a set of enterprise gateways and storage hubs (hereinafter enterprise gateways). Each sensor network includes a set of sensor peers and at least one super peer. The super peer manages the sensor network and communicates with the set of sensor collector information gateways. The autonomic sensor network ecosystem of the present invention is deployed and allocated in such a manner that backup and resiliency is provided.
